    Cannot install AVG WatchDog

    Yesterday I am demanding to install AVG 2011and the installation procedure shows an error. The error as below
    • Error Code: 0xc0070643
    • Message : General internal error
    • Service 'AVG WatchDog' cannot not be installed. Make sure that you have enough privileges in order to install system services.
    • Contex: MSI action failed

    I am not sure why I don’t have enough privileges even if I login as administrator. I really want to use this antivirus but I don’t know how. Can anyone tell me what is meant by this error and how can I pass over this?

    Re: Cannot install AVG WatchDog

    Normal and restricted user accounts usually do not have the appropriate privileges to create changes to Windows therefore for all time log into a Windows through a user account that has complete administrator privileges while installing whichever software counting AVG. Majority of antispyware, parental control plus process monitor kinds of security program can block the necessary modifications while installing AVG program, thus make sure to put out of action them while installing otherwise uninstalling AVG.     Re: Cannot install AVG WatchDog

    Windows has a region within the registry that is usually utilized to assist debug program problems except furthermore has additional uses. Occasionally malware will put in a registry door toward this Window's registry key with the intention that while you attempt to run AVG otherwise additional security software, the malware otherwise other program is essentially run in its place. During these cases, the registry entries that might have been prepared should be physically removed with the intention that AVG can work correctly and install without any errors.

    Re: Cannot install AVG WatchDog

    I think that you might have used the AVG before but didn’t uninstall it properly. AVG Remover takes out each and every one the parts of the AVG installation from your PC, counting registry entries, installed files, user files, and so on. AVG Remover is the final choice which you can use for when AVG uninstall / repair installation procedure has failed frequently.
